Transaction 99a50080989f8744c8534c1a69be1a60382307b0532aa28a59100edcacb49d89
1 Input
1 Output
-
99a50080989f8744c8534c1a69be1a60382307b0532aa28a59100edcacb49d89:0
- value
- 591909
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 18ccba93aa186864db8f149c45522859b4c4842d5ffcd25fafc14831c3cf46d4
- address
- bc1prrxt4ya2rp5xfku0zjwy253gtx6vfppdtl7dyha0c9yrrs70gm2qv4uvc9